The order issued ahead of the July 4 holiday weekend, applies to counties with 20 or more confirmed COVID-19 cases, Abbott's office said in a statement

Texas Governor Greg Abbott, a Republican and partner of US President Donald Trump, on Thursday gave an official request requiring face covers in broad daylight spaces as the state marks record quantities of new diseases.

The request gave in front of the July 4 occasion end of the week, applies to regions with at least 20 affirmed COVID-19 cases, Abbott's office said in articulation.

The representative likewise restricted get-togethers of in excess of 10 individuals and ordered social removing of six feet (two meters).

"We can keep organizations open and push our economy ahead with the goal that Texans can keep on gaining a check, however it requires every one of us to do our part to secure each other - and that implies wearing a face-covering in broad daylight spaces," Abbott stated, referring to the viability of covers in easing back the spread of the coronavirus.

"Limiting the size of gathering social affairs will reinforce Texas' capacity to corral this infection and protect Texans," he said.

Abbott's requests came after the circumstance in Houston, America's fourth-biggest city pointedly declined in the previous fourteen days.

Texas on Wednesday revealed a record 8,076 coronavirus cases in 24 hours, 1,000 more than the record high daily prior.

In general, Texas has recorded more than 175,000 coronavirus cases.

Abbott's requests came the same number of Republican authorities, who were at first tepid about the significance of wearing covers, start openly calling for face covers as the United States sees taking off quantities of new diseases
